Responsibilities

The Space & Intelligence Division supports customers across DoD Space and the Intelligence Community ranging from USSF, OSD SCO, and other DoD entities, and IC organizations such as the NRO, NGA, NSA, and others. We conduct systems engineering (including all aspects of digital engineering, modeling, simulation, and analysis, architecture evaluation, requirements analysis, test and evaluation, and transition to operations), acquisition, program management, financial management, and related support to development, integration, and operations of systems for remote sensing, communications, position navigation, and timing, GEOINT, SIGINT, launch, and other critical space/intel mission areas. Division organizations operate in multiple locations including Northern Virginia, Colorado Springs, Los Angeles, and many others. The Division is actively growing through both organic and inorganic (M&A) growth.

This position provides direct support to the SVP and Division Director for Space & Intel, including integrating and supporting efforts conducted by 3 groups, multiple contracts, and over 300 personnel. Detailed duties include:

    Managing schedules, maintaining calendars, setting appointments, and keeping managers informed of constantly changing situations.
  • Routing and tracking internal and external written communication.
  • Developing and refining processes and systems to manage branch workflow supporting all Division leadership and staff.
  • Scheduling and coordinating both virtual and in-person conference rooms.
  • Managing branch files and records, databases, and business unit calendars.
  • Scheduling travel and preparing vouchers after travel in a timely manner.
  • Maintaining, updating, and editing a variety of routine documents and reports.
  • Assisting in on-boarding new personnel and ensuring workspace accommodations.
  • Compiling technical, financial, and other project/program information for inclusion in reports and presentations.
  • Conducting queries of open-source databases related to contracts and business opportunities.
  • Supporting office operations for multiple tenants to include supporting security and IT activities associated with SCIF operations.
  • Assisting in development of management presentations, creating PowerPoint charts, Excel tables, and Word documents.
  • Experience supporting/hosting customer conferences/meetings - help with agenda, attendees, logistics, food service, and other vendor interfaces.
  • Supporting proposal efforts with administrative support.
  • Other administrative duties, as required.
Qualifications

Required Qualifications:

  • Associate's degree or equivalent experience in office administration or a related field
  • 5-10 years' experience providing programmatic and administrative support to IC facing organizations and customers
  • Ability to communicate with senior personnel, exercise discretion, and maintain confidentiality
  • Proficiency in Microsoft Office, including Word, Excel, PowerPoint, and Outlook
  • Must have a TS/SCI clearance

Desired Qualifications:

  • Bachelor's Degree
  • Familiarity with Business related information systems such as G2X, GovWin, and others
  • Demonstrated experience supporting contract PMRs and proposal development
  • Familiarity with government/industry outreach organizations such as INSA, NDIA, AFCEA, and others
